Output 76cd91ddd1495074ddabf1d96bdb3e7d8393c7c02a362fd10c02ffb92a532895:4

value
979826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70afc27c87e5bc06a3073680ab8e5150dced5a01 OP_EQUAL
address
3BxrA2ZQA9bfNn4gxBKofJfKDDt5t2VT5E
transaction
76cd91ddd1495074ddabf1d96bdb3e7d8393c7c02a362fd10c02ffb92a532895
spent
true